Dr. Anthony Marrone, DC, DACRB, Cert. MDT, CSCS

  • Diplomate of the American Chiropractic Rehabilitation Board (DACRB)
    • Completed an extensive three-year post–graduate education in physical rehabilitation through the Southern California University of Health Sciences.
    • Dr. Marrone is the first chiropractor in Oregon to have earned the DACRB designation.
    • Passed an extensive four-level testing program by the American Chiropractic Rehabilitation Board.
  • Doctor Of Chiropractic-D.C. (2001) from Western States Chiropractic College Portland, Oregon
    • Graduated Summa Cum Laude
    • Clinical Excellence Award–2001
  • Cert. MDT: Certified provider in Mechanical Diagnosis & Therapy (The McKenzie Method)
  •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S)- National Strength Coaches Association since 2002
  • Integrated Care Provider
    • Consulting chiropractic physician for the Alternative Medicine Consultation Clinic at the Center for Women’s Health, Oregon Health Sciences University. Portland, Oregon.
  • National Presentations
    • Trigeminal Neuralgia Association- 6th Annual Conference: Treatment of Orofacial Pain through Chiropractic Care and Physical Rehabilitation
  • Other Presentations
    • Oregon Health Sciences University (OHSU) CAM Grand Rounds- Provided a Chiropractic and Physical Rehabilitation perspective on numerous topics including: Multiple Sclerosis, Parkinson’s Diseases Chronic Low Back Pain, Neck Pain, Headaches, Fibromyalgia, Pain in Children, Neuropathic Disorders, Mental Health, Aging, and other topics.
